7 Pa. Code § 401.15. Alternate TCO2 protocol and levels.

§ 401.15. Alternate TCO2 protocol and levels.

 (a)  The Commission may establish an alternate protocol to determine the levels of total carbon dioxide (TCO2) in a horse using the same methods and procedures as the Base Excess testing, except that the horse’s second blood sample may be obtained, sealed and secured and stored in the same manner as post-racing samples. The second blood sample taken from a horse with a positive Base Excess may be forwarded to the Commission Testing Laboratory and subjected to post-race testing in accordance with the Commission’s regulations.

 (b)  Standardbred TCO2 levels: A blood serum or plasma TCO2 level shall not exceed 37.0 millimoles per liter in a non-Furosemide (non-Lasix) horse and not to exceed 39 mmol/L for a Furosemide (Lasix) horse.
